Role
• Design and architect scalable solutions for Cloud-native SaaS development projects.
• Work with containerization technologies and orchestration software such as Kubernetes on cloud platforms like AWS and Azure.
• Develop and implement Microservices-based architecture using Java, SpringBoot, ReactJS, NextJS, and other relevant technologies.
• Implement secure design principles and practices, ensuring the integrity and confidentiality of our systems.
• Collaborate with cross-functional teams to define and refine requirements and specifications.
• Deploy workloads at scale in AWS EKS/ECS environments.
• Utilize Multi-Factor Authentication and Single Sign-On (OAuth, SAML) for enhanced security.
• Work with various AWS services such as EC2, EKS, and others as needed.
• Implement DevOps methodologies and tools for continuous integration and delivery.
• Utilize APM and Monitoring Tools like ELK, Splunk, Datadog, Dynatrace, and Appdynamics for cloud-scale monitoring.
• Stay updated on industry best practices, emerging technologies, and cybersecurity trends.
Requirements
- 12+ years of overall experience in software development and architecture.
- Certified AWS Architect - AWS Certified Solutions Architect Professional.
- Strong knowledge and experience in Cloud-native SaaS development and
architecture. - Proficient in Java, Python, RESTful APIs, API Gateway, Kafka, and Microservices
communications. - Experience with RDBMS and NoSQL databases (e.g., Neo4J, MongoDB, Redis).
- Experience in working with Graph databases like Neo4J.
- Expertise in containerization technologies (Docker) and Kubernetes.
- Hands-on experience with secure DevOps practices.
- Familiarity with Multi-Factor Authentication and Single Sign-On principles.
- Excellent verbal and written communication skills.
- Self-starter with strong organizational and problem-solving skills.
- Prior experience in deploying workloads at scale in AWS EKS/ECS/Fargate.
- Knowledge of Cloud-scale APM and Monitoring Tools (ELK, Splunk, Datadog, etc.).
- Previous experience in Cybersecurity products is desirable but not mandatory.
If you are a highly skilled Software Architect looking to make a significant impact in the development of innovative and secure cloud solutions, we invite you to apply and join our dynamic team.